TEMPERATURE SENSITIVE MULTICOPY PLASMIDS ABSTRACT A plasmid is described of ColEl type parentage which has a temperature sensitive replication system such that the plasmid copy number in a given host cell may be controlled by a temperature shift. The plasmid permits the use of temperature as a switch for controlling gene amplification and hence production of corresponding protein in a cell.
